DeepFlow开源项目与其他开源项目相比有何优势?
在当今数字化时代,开源项目已成为推动技术发展的重要力量。其中,DeepFlow开源项目以其独特的优势在众多开源项目中脱颖而出。本文将深入探讨DeepFlow开源项目与其他开源项目相比的优势,帮助读者全面了解其价值。
一、技术优势
高性能的分布式流处理能力:DeepFlow采用先进的分布式流处理技术,能够高效地处理海量数据。与其他开源项目相比,DeepFlow在处理速度和吞吐量方面具有明显优势。
高可用性:DeepFlow采用集群架构,具备强大的容错能力。在节点故障、网络故障等情况下,DeepFlow仍能保证系统正常运行,确保数据处理的连续性和稳定性。
易扩展性:DeepFlow支持水平扩展,可根据实际需求灵活调整资源。这使得DeepFlow在处理大规模数据时,能够快速适应负载变化,满足不同场景下的需求。
二、功能优势
实时数据流处理:DeepFlow支持实时数据流处理,可实时分析数据,为用户提供实时洞察。与其他开源项目相比,DeepFlow在实时性方面具有明显优势。
丰富的数据处理功能:DeepFlow提供丰富的数据处理功能,包括数据清洗、转换、聚合等。这使得DeepFlow能够满足用户在数据处理方面的各种需求。
可视化界面:DeepFlow提供直观易用的可视化界面,用户可通过图形化方式配置数据处理流程,降低使用门槛。
三、社区优势
活跃的社区:DeepFlow拥有一个活跃的社区,用户可以在这里获取技术支持、交流经验、分享最佳实践。
持续迭代:DeepFlow团队持续关注用户需求,不断优化产品功能,为用户提供更好的使用体验。
四、案例分析
以某大型电商平台为例,该平台使用DeepFlow进行实时数据流处理,实现了以下效果:
实时监控用户行为:通过DeepFlow,平台能够实时监控用户行为,分析用户喜好,为用户提供个性化推荐。
优化库存管理:DeepFlow帮助平台实时分析销售数据,优化库存管理,降低库存成本。
提升系统性能:DeepFlow的分布式架构,使平台在处理海量数据时,仍能保持高性能,提升用户体验。
五、总结
DeepFlow开源项目凭借其高性能、易用性、社区优势等优势,在众多开源项目中脱颖而出。在未来,DeepFlow将继续为用户提供优质的产品和服务,推动数据流处理技术的发展。
猜你喜欢:全栈可观测